Здравствуйте! Меня зовут Алексей, и я хотел бы поделиться с вами своим опытом работы с языком программирования Python.
Одной из важных концепций в Python являются функции. Функция ─ это некий блок кода, который выполняет определенную задачу. Она может принимать аргументы и возвращать результат. Сегодня я расскажу вам о функции, которая называется ″nums″.Функция ″nums″ принимает два аргумента⁚ a и b. Задача этой функции заключается в том, чтобы определить, больше ли значение a, чем значение b. Если это условие выполняется, функция возвращает произведение a и b. В противном случае, она возвращает сумму a и b.Давайте рассмотрим, как это можно реализовать в коде⁚
python
def nums(a, b)⁚
if a > b⁚ # Если a больше b
return a * b # Возвращаем произведение a и b
else⁚
return a b # Возвращаем сумму a и b
a int(input(″Введите значение a⁚ ″)) # Пользователь вводит значение a
b int(input(″Введите значение b⁚ ″)) # Пользователь вводит значение b
result nums(a, b) # Вызываем функцию nums с аргументами a и b
Давайте разберем этот код подробнее. Сначала мы объявляем функцию ″nums″ с двумя аргументами ‒ a и b. Внутри функции мы проверяем, больше ли a, чем b. Если это условие выполняется, мы возвращаем произведение a и b с помощью оператора умножения. Если условие не выполняется, мы возвращаем сумму a и b с помощью оператора сложения.
Затем, мы просим пользователя ввести значения a и b с помощью функции input. Обратите внимание, что для этой задачи нам не требуется принимать какой-либо аргумент для функции input, поэтому мы оставляем ее пустой.
Далее, мы вызываем функцию ″nums″ с аргументами a и b и сохраняем результат в переменную result. Наконец, мы выводим результат работы функции на экран с помощью функции print.
Для проверки работы программы, предлагаю ввести два числа ‒ одно больше другого. Например, введите значение a равное 5 и значение b равное 3. Программа должна вывести на экран произведение 5 и 3, то есть число 15.
Я надеюсь, что моя статья о функции ″nums″ в языке программирования Python была полезной и понятной для вас. Удачи в изучении Python!